British Homeopathic Journal, Table of Contents Br Homeopath J 1996; 85(01): 15-16DOI: 10.1016/S0007-0785(96)80019-6 Copyright © The Faculty of Homeopathy 1996 Growth-promoting effect of sulphur 201c in pigs Authors Germán Guajardo-Bernal Roberto Searcy-Bernal José Soto-Avila Subject Editor: Recommend Article Abstract Buy Article(opens in new window) Abstract In a blind, placebo-controlled trial, a homoeopathic dynamized dilution of Sulphur 201c was given orally to pregnant sows every 10 days. No significant difference was detected between the birth weight of litters (39 piglets) of treated sows and control litters (40 piglets). On day 30 statistically significant differences were observed both in the final weight of litters, mean total and daily weight gain. Keywords KeywordsHomoeopathic drugs - Growth promoters Full Text
